Review: AssemblyVisualizer 📌
AssemblyVisualizer is a data visualization plugin for .NET decompilers, currently supporting ILSpy and Reflector. It provides a graphical representation of the assembly and helps developers understand the structure and dependencies of their code.

Alternative 1 🏆: .NET Assembly Dependency Analyzer
Description: A simple application that displays a focused graph describing the inheritance hierarchy between a set of .NET assemblies.
👍 Why Choose: If you need a tool specifically for analyzing the inheritance hierarchy of .NET assemblies, this alternative provides a focused graph representation.
👎 Why Not: If you require additional visualization capabilities beyond analyzing inheritance, this alternative may not meet your needs.
